Whilst I doubt I will win - the link(s) below will get picked up by spiders <img src="http://www.ubbdev.com/forum/images/graemlins/grin.gif" alt="" /><br /><br />My site is 'Non League UK' - we support non-league football (soccer) teams in the UK - this means any team that is below the Football League - usually these are part-time teams - but we go right down to grass-roots, and do not exclude any team however small.<br /><br />Essentially it works on the basis that each club that would like a forum (they just ask for a free forum) is allocated a category - and a unique URL - e.g. http://forums.nonleague.com/hornchurch which they then include on their own website - anyone clicking on that link will get their clubs forum, a forum for the league that their team plays in and a few communal forums shared by everyone. We have a menu system so that users can navigate to other club forums etc. This means that small clubs have their own area, and are not swamped by the bigger clubs.<br /><br />Depending upon their club, they get a different sidebar showing for each club or league (have completed 100+ so far out of over 1,000) this gives the extra navigation to results, league tables etc., and shows their club badge down the side. forums.howwhatwhy.com<br /><br />Mostly technical modifications:<br /><br />- Migrated UBB.Threads from MySQL to PostgreSQL.<br /><br />- Improved performance significantly (we currently have 230,000 posts).<br /><br />- Automatically generated "hot topics" based on activity in threads.<br /><br />- "Dynamic view" in addition to flat and threaded.<br /><br />- Added AIM and Yahoo messenger online status, plus clicking the online status icon opens an IM window (if the IM is installed, of course...).<br /><br />- Quite a lot of minor stuff, e.g. mods can see IP used to send PMs, mods/admins have a "ban" button on the "who's online" screen, users can have all replies to their posts emailed to them, allow users to edit their own titles, UBB.Codes for underline, superscript and subscript, quoting doesn't "nest" quotes from previous message, and many more.
